The Core Components of Your Shutter

The first thing everyone notices is the louvers. These are the angled slats that you can tilt to let light in or shut it out completely. Think of them as the workhorses of your shutter, giving you total control over sunlight and privacy.

The louvers fit inside a solid frame that gives the shutter its strength and shape. This frame is made of a few key pieces:

  • Stiles: These are the strong vertical side pieces of the shutter panel. They’re the backbone of the shutter, holding the louvers securely in place.
  • Rails: The horizontal pieces at the top and bottom are called rails. On taller shutters, you’ll often find a divider rail in the middle, which adds strength and lets you operate the top and bottom louvers separately.
  • Tilt Rod: This is how you adjust the louvers. A traditional shutter has the tilt rod running down the front, but many modern designs hide it for a cleaner, more contemporary look.

All these parts have to work together perfectly. The stiles and rails create a tough frame that won’t warp or sag, while the tilt rod gives you easy, smooth control. This is how a simple design delivers so many benefits.

A Rich History of Functional Design

This smart design has been around for centuries, getting better with every generation. Louvered shutters started in ancient Greece for ventilation and privacy. By the 1700s, they were a must-have in American colonial homes, especially here in the South where they helped beat the Tennessee heat.

Finding the Right Shutter Material

The material is the heart and soul of your shutter, defining its character from the ground up. Whether you love the classic warmth of real wood or need the hardworking resilience of a modern composite, there’s an option that’s just right for your home. Let's walk through the most popular choices we offer to families in Jackson, Milan, and across West Tennessee.

  • Classic Hardwood Shutters: There’s simply no substitute for the authentic, timeless beauty of real wood. Hardwood shutters offer a richness that can be stained to let the natural grain pop or painted in literally any color you can dream up. This gives you incredible design flexibility, making them a stunning focal point in living rooms, bedrooms, and dining areas.

  • Durable Composite Shutters: Have a room that deals with a lot of humidity, like a kitchen, bathroom, or laundry area? Composite shutters are your best friend. Built from tough engineered wood and sealed with a durable coating, they’re designed to resist moisture, so you never have to worry about warping or cracking. You get the substantial look of wood with the muscle needed for tougher environments.

  • Modern Vinyl Shutters: If you’re looking for a budget-friendly option that’s a breeze to maintain, vinyl is the answer. These shutters are 100% waterproof, stand up to scratches, and are incredibly simple to clean. This makes them a perfect, worry-free choice for high-traffic homes, kids' rooms, or playrooms.

Deciding on the Perfect Louver Size

After you've landed on a material, it's time to pick your louver size. This single choice has a huge impact on your view, your light control, and the overall style of your louvered shutters for windows. It’s like choosing the perfect lens for a camera—each one frames the world a little differently.

Louver sizes generally range from a traditional 2.5 inches to a wide-open, contemporary 4.5 inches. The size you pick can completely change the feel of your room.

Louver Size Comparison

Louver Size Best For Visual Effect
2.5 inches Traditional or historic homes, smaller windows Creates that classic, colonial look with more louvers per panel. Offers pinpoint privacy control.
3.5 inches Versatile for most home styles, standard choice This is our most popular option for a reason. It perfectly balances a clear view with a timeless style that works in almost any room.
4.5 inches Modern or contemporary homes, large windows Gives you the most unobstructed, panoramic view and lets in a flood of natural light. Creates a bold, airy, and open atmosphere.

Lately, the trend has been leaning toward wider louvers (3.5" and 4.5") because they provide a cleaner, more expansive view of the outdoors, making rooms feel bigger and brighter. That said, the classic 2.5" louver is still the perfect fit for maintaining a traditional look or for smaller windows where big louvers might feel out of scale. Precision Light and Privacy Management

Beyond saving energy, custom louvered shutters for windows give you total control over the atmosphere in your home. Curtains and blinds are basically an all-or-nothing deal—open or closed. But with adjustable louvers, you can fine-tune the natural light in any room.

  • Total Blackout: Shut the louvers completely for near-total darkness, which is perfect for bedrooms and home theaters.
  • Soft, Diffused Light: Tilt them just right to bounce sunlight off the ceiling, filling the space with a gentle glow without any harsh glare.
  • Strategic Privacy: Angle the louvers so you can still see out into your yard, but nosy neighbors can't see in.

This level of control only comes when shutters fit your windows perfectly. With generic, store-bought products, you'll always have those annoying light gaps around the edges, which ruins both your privacy and the room-darkening effect. Our custom process gets rid of those gaps completely.

How Do I Keep My Louvered Shutters Looking New?

Honestly, one of the best parts about our shutters is how little work they are. Keeping your new louvered shutters for windows looking pristine for years to come is incredibly simple.

A quick pass with a feather duster or soft microfiber cloth is all you need for regular dusting. If you see a smudge or fingerprint, just use a slightly damp cloth with a tiny bit of mild soap and wipe it away.

  • Avoid Harsh Chemicals: Stick to simple soap and water. Abrasive cleaners and solvents can damage the beautiful finish on your shutters.
  • Material-Specific Care: We’ll give you all the details for your specific shutters. Natural wood might love an occasional polish, but composite and vinyl just need a simple wipe-down.

This easy routine means your investment stays beautiful for decades, making shutters a truly practical choice for any busy household.

Can Louvered Shutters Really Fit Any Window Shape?

Yes, absolutely! This is where custom louvered shutters for windows truly shine. Their incredible versatility means we can have them crafted to fit almost any window you can imagine, no matter how unique or tricky.

Standard windows are just the start. We specialize in creating stunning, perfectly functional shutters for all kinds of architectural features:

  • Arched Windows: We can design gorgeous sunburst or full-arch shutters that trace the curve of your window perfectly.
  • Circular and Oval Windows: These unique shapes become incredible focal points when fitted with custom shutters.
  • Bay and Bow Windows: Our experts craft shutters for multi-angled windows, creating a seamless, elegant look that flows.
  • French Doors and Sliding Glass Doors: We can mount shutters directly onto your doors for privacy and light control without getting in the way.
